Commit Graph

335 Commits

Author SHA1 Message Date
Changhua
3658796a00 feat(message): impl wechat log 2025-02-17 00:42:41 +08:00
Changhua
2297afa25d fix(rpc_server): fix log function 2025-02-16 13:52:31 +08:00
Changhua
f6ceb8139a feat(rpc_server): integrate MessageHandler into RpcServer 2025-02-13 00:13:29 +08:00
Changhua
fdeda6d413 feat(rpc_server): integrate MessageHandler into RpcServer 2025-02-13 00:10:04 +08:00
Changhua
e121000efa refactor(account): update rpc_get_user_info with new fill_response template 2025-02-12 01:32:26 +08:00
Changhua
95e90e4afb refactor(rpc): add fill_response template 2025-02-12 01:19:19 +08:00
Changhua
32876209a4 feat(account): add user info retrieval and RPC methods 2025-02-12 00:47:54 +08:00
Changhua
8808c78f8e refactor(util:dbg_msg): switch to OutputDebugStringW for better Unicode support 2025-02-10 20:42:53 +08:00
Changhua
649e627b4f Refactoring 2025-02-10 20:32:29 +08:00
Changhua
a9be7b094d Refactoring 2025-02-07 07:51:44 +08:00
Changhua
2df74fb4d2 Refactoring 2025-02-07 07:41:14 +08:00
Changhua
9232bab9e0 Refactoring 2025-02-06 19:33:16 +08:00
Changhua
2e240c3731 Refactoring 2025-02-06 08:05:35 +08:00
Changhua
8653f6f521 Refactoring 2025-02-06 07:44:52 +08:00
Changhua
730f51344c Refactoring 2025-02-06 07:02:19 +08:00
Changhua
d4707997ba Refacoring 2025-02-05 23:07:46 +08:00
Changhua
505eefd03c Refactoring 2025-02-05 16:05:40 +08:00
Changhua
228ebbf4d1 Refactoring 2025-02-05 09:17:50 +08:00
Changhua
b99a3aa377 Refactoring 2025-02-05 08:44:16 +08:00
Changhua
b5d2f39002 Refactoring 2025-02-05 08:16:44 +08:00
Changhua
53370ca8b6 Refactoring 2025-02-04 22:52:36 +08:00
Changhua
0d228745ac Refactoring 2025-02-04 22:29:54 +08:00
Changhua
9e306e2452 Refactoring 2025-02-04 22:07:36 +08:00
Changhua
1cbd3a3ebe Refatoring 2025-02-04 21:00:29 +08:00
Changhua
e012efc682 Refactoring 2025-02-04 20:40:46 +08:00
Changhua
1bec8ce8a2 Refactoring 2025-02-04 17:34:48 +08:00
Changhua
dc51b7b5a7 Refactoring 2025-02-04 17:27:35 +08:00
Changhua
c96d85db30 Refactoring 2025-02-04 15:35:09 +08:00
Changhua
796e078c0c Remove unused code 2025-02-04 10:09:33 +08:00
Changhua
66e14be136 Refactoring 2025-02-04 05:27:07 +08:00
Changhua
b426e84241 Refatoring 2025-02-03 23:18:41 +08:00
Changhua
ff1a8c9807 Refactoring 2025-02-03 23:18:20 +08:00
Changhua
0fd3449894 Refactoring 2025-02-03 21:40:22 +08:00
Changhua
b79e163cc9 Refactoring 2025-02-03 21:36:39 +08:00
Changhua
e5480bf667 Refactoring 2025-02-03 21:20:22 +08:00
Changhua
7dd1887dcf Refactoring 2025-02-02 08:54:12 +08:00
Changhua
ada071c7d2 Refactoring 2025-02-01 18:48:56 +08:00
Changhua
ff5f2378c0 Refactoring 2025-02-01 08:45:28 +08:00
Changhua
2033ae2ab8 Refactoring 2025-01-31 11:17:41 +08:00
Changhua
da4dcec8bc Refactoring 2025-01-31 11:06:26 +08:00
Changhua
065db1d236 Fix function signature 2025-01-31 10:51:35 +08:00
Changhua
b109bd72d2 Refactoring 2025-01-31 10:18:02 +08:00
Changhua
f2c017de10 Refatoring 2025-01-31 09:55:44 +08:00
Changhua
bc40b6e922 Fix logging and compiling errors 2025-01-31 09:54:08 +08:00
Changhua
86a55cf00c refactoring 2025-01-31 01:08:55 +08:00
Changhua
bfe3336753 refactor: use template to simplify response logic 2025-01-31 00:50:19 +08:00
Changhua
d59aa751cb Refactoring 2025-01-30 22:30:56 +08:00
Changhua
7f4f1c54d6 Remove unused code 2025-01-30 20:47:06 +08:00
Changhua
2a27dec354 Refactor: replace C-style code with modern C++ idioms 2025-01-30 20:34:45 +08:00
Changhua
15267632a1 Refactor: replace C-style code with modern C++ idioms 2025-01-29 18:32:20 +08:00
Changhua
554d62efcf Refactor: replace C-style code with modern C++ idioms 2025-01-28 20:31:51 +08:00
Changhua
65670b4ea7 Refactoring 2025-01-27 12:19:54 +08:00
Changhua
efc4688873 Refactoring 2025-01-27 12:11:41 +08:00
Changhua
a273d6f11a Make a DISCLAIMER copy 2025-01-26 23:31:43 +08:00
Changhua
3f5eec4ef1 Add license check for running 2025-01-26 23:18:59 +08:00
Changhua
f4943b8eee Add license check for compiling 2025-01-26 19:44:40 +08:00
dillon520
0a3dc505cd 更新Update funcs.cpp,为了保持代码简洁和风格一致,使用fs::exists和fs::create_directories替换_access和CreateDir 2025-01-06 15:02:49 +08:00
Changhua
b339c526f6 Bump to v39.3.5 2025-01-05 22:22:22 +08:00
dillon520
52dc88a121 如果下载图片指定的输出目录不存在,会失败
修改:检测输出目录是否存在,如果不存在就创建该目录。
2025-01-04 18:17:44 +08:00
Changhua
0dbe4cdf75 Add builtin-baseline 2024-12-30 15:44:08 +08:00
Changhua
66813b186c Fix include path 2024-12-30 15:42:35 +08:00
Changhua
d921989440 Fix include path 2024-12-29 15:23:24 +08:00
Changhua
4cf74f28d9 Refactoring 2024-11-21 13:26:31 +08:00
Changhua
7274163053 Refactoring 2024-11-21 13:10:07 +08:00
Changhua
9162ae7e05 Bump to v39.3.4 2024-11-21 13:03:22 +08:00
eric
daaed3909c feat:支持获取登录二维码 2024-11-21 10:24:39 +08:00
yuzifu
f56c4e3ccb Fix GetAppMsgMgr offset 2024-11-13 08:44:42 +08:00
Changhua
f41b248023 Bump to v39.3.3 2024-11-03 18:41:44 +08:00
Changhua
5ca2eb65f3 Fix #140 #220 2024-11-03 18:39:15 +08:00
Changhua
075de2e5fe
Merge pull request #201 from conbein49/master
修复windows下无法发送中文名文件的问题
2024-11-03 18:34:50 +08:00
Changhua
3aeae5338d Update RoomData 2024-11-03 16:07:53 +08:00
Changhua
d9f282317a Bump to v39.3.2 2024-11-03 13:56:42 +08:00
Changhua
24703ccc9b Fix #266 2024-11-03 13:28:24 +08:00
Changhua
a15a42503a Add RoomData 2024-11-03 10:27:39 +08:00
Changhua
75b1437627 Enable vcpkg manifests 2024-11-03 10:26:24 +08:00
Changhua
8f46f56cb6 Bump to v39.3.1 2024-11-02 13:48:02 +08:00
Changhua
edf8974785 Merge remote-tracking branch 'origin/3.9.11.25' 2024-11-02 12:41:57 +08:00
yuzifu
bad06ac7f0 Fix SendMsgMgr offset 2024-11-01 16:13:06 +08:00
Changhua
d21ecb3706 Add build options 2024-11-01 00:29:46 +08:00
Changhua
b05756fec3 Fix sendXML 2024-11-01 00:29:11 +08:00
Changhua
af34a151d5 Bump to v39.3.0 2024-10-31 23:16:08 +08:00
Changhua
c66b1f7eb2 Fix SendXmlMessage 2024-10-31 22:59:27 +08:00
Changhua
86c0920445 Reformat 2024-10-31 22:53:01 +08:00
Changhua
b8701111da
Merge pull request #243 from lzb112/3.9.11.25
发送XML,OK编译通过,群主开测吧
2024-10-07 13:12:49 +08:00
wxlinzebin
d00edd8add OK编译通过,群主测吧 2024-09-26 23:24:35 +08:00
lzb
7efe6bce55 没测过的发送xml.. 2024-09-26 19:53:15 +08:00
kingmo888
19079bc468 修复因无logs文件夹导致启动失败的问题。c++项目增加 /utf8兼容,解决编码异常问题。 2024-09-26 08:46:09 +08:00
yuzifu
3d95fc34b7 Update partial offset for 3.9.11.25 2024-09-23 15:16:52 +08:00
yuzifu
8f9d10bf3b Update partial offset for 3.9.11.25 2024-09-20 16:27:15 +08:00
yuzifu
8098a8e9d8 Update partial offset for 3.9.11.25 2024-09-19 19:24:23 +08:00
huangjiechen
bf4a7eea7d 修复windows下无法发送中文名文件的问题 2024-08-08 17:10:29 +08:00
Changhua
bf8e6bddb9 Fix merge issues 2024-07-26 21:55:15 +08:00
Changhua
59a4c318ff Resolve merge conflict 2024-07-26 21:50:39 +08:00
Changhua
bbbaeb570a v39.2.4 2024-07-08 21:26:50 +08:00
Changhua
3b7bd72e00 Fix wxid 2024-07-08 21:20:54 +08:00
Changhua
478bbdfdab Impl x32/x64 check 2024-07-08 00:51:26 +08:00
Changhua
43f9f76d83 v39.2.3 2024-07-04 19:09:47 +08:00
Changhua
f76aed268e Impl send gif 2024-07-04 18:40:58 +08:00
Changhua
c922842b22 v39.2.2 2024-07-03 18:37:08 +08:00
Changhua
38464e6450 Fix Hook/Unhook issue 2024-07-03 18:36:52 +08:00
Changhua
f805a38ca8 v39.2.1 2024-07-02 22:42:10 +08:00
Changhua
e66b61aa67 Refactoring 2024-07-02 22:03:59 +08:00
Changhua
81c8a3b135 Refatoring 2024-07-02 21:12:21 +08:00
Changhua
db08382e56 Refactoring 2024-07-02 00:50:20 +08:00
Changhua
7a4f406220 Fix #51 2024-07-02 00:40:04 +08:00
Changhua
668f984240 Refactoring 2024-07-01 07:59:39 +08:00
Changhua
642fa63b39 Impl download attachments 2024-06-30 16:49:33 +08:00
Changhua
5481e6d3ec Fix operator 2024-06-30 16:23:12 +08:00
Changhua
9101b37162 Impl refresh pyq 2024-06-29 18:18:22 +08:00
Changhua
e7aad958c8 Update login flag 2024-06-29 17:15:29 +08:00
Changhua
d59f7f7397 Refactoring 2024-06-28 22:26:22 +08:00
Changhua
45cb2816eb Fix unhandled error 2024-06-28 20:21:36 +08:00
Changhua
ec2ad71ccf Impl WX logging 2024-06-28 20:15:29 +08:00
Changhua
a1a94d946c Update target name 2024-06-28 20:12:42 +08:00
Changhua
b594db83ba Update Project Configuration 2024-06-28 00:49:28 +08:00
Changhua
746c52b125 Update Project Configuration 2024-06-28 00:19:40 +08:00
Changhua
a66d269ce4 Fix building errors 2024-06-28 00:03:34 +08:00
Changhua
d56163709c Impl invite chatroom members 2024-06-27 21:13:32 +08:00
Changhua
64a3a916f0 Update invite chatroom member offsets 2024-06-27 21:12:37 +08:00
Changhua
1dc476fb5b Impl delete chatroom members 2024-06-27 21:08:37 +08:00
Changhua
820abd826b Refactoring 2024-06-27 21:06:08 +08:00
Changhua
75858ef0f3 Update delete chatroom member offsets 2024-06-27 20:57:25 +08:00
Changhua
02030a4af0 Impl add chatroom member 2024-06-26 22:37:52 +08:00
Changhua
1724009d5b Update AddChatroomMember offsets 2024-06-26 22:37:06 +08:00
Changhua
770f56de50 Refactoring 2024-06-25 18:38:27 +08:00
Changhua
bd0387882d Impl NewWxStringFromStr and NewWxStringFromWstr 2024-06-24 21:37:47 +08:00
Changhua
4554f2376a Impl get_contacts 2024-06-23 19:38:15 +08:00
wxlinzebin
18e1726e2e PR专用 2024-06-22 22:57:30 +08:00
Changhua
ad848b69f1 Update get contacts offsets 2024-06-22 15:15:04 +08:00
Changhua
d605dedf00 Impl DecryptImage 2024-06-21 18:59:29 +08:00
Changhua
3b96b1737d Impl forward message 2024-06-20 21:37:31 +08:00
Changhua
d69f2b1eec Update forward message call 2024-06-20 21:36:25 +08:00
Changhua
6512b73164 Fix db index 2024-06-19 01:11:40 +08:00
Changhua
9ce3a008dd Fix data types 2024-06-18 18:51:37 +08:00
Changhua
b01b61f84d Impl db related functions 2024-06-17 20:38:08 +08:00
Changhua
7a8ee47473 Support MediaMsgi.db 2024-06-16 15:28:34 +08:00
Changhua
9030017e5d Impl sql funcs 2024-06-15 20:57:18 +08:00
Changhua
1bfde90d99 Adapt x64 sqlite3 2024-06-14 00:56:22 +08:00
Changhua
d2e793d3fc Adapt x64 codec 2024-06-13 23:29:52 +08:00
Changhua
f93b66fe36 Impl send pat message 2024-06-12 01:07:17 +08:00
Changhua
f2c8a22fff Update send pat message offset 2024-06-12 01:05:51 +08:00
Changhua
a7cdd750b1 Impl send rich text 2024-06-12 00:34:01 +08:00
Changhua
8286f9ab58 Update send richtext offset 2024-06-11 23:29:30 +08:00
Changhua
6133c22169 Remove unused variables 2024-06-10 17:53:27 +08:00
Changhua
3ec0c9306b Impl send file 2024-06-10 17:44:48 +08:00
Changhua
644561af6a Update send file offset 2024-06-10 17:43:28 +08:00
Changhua
1d15ab16c4 Fix typos 2024-06-10 16:35:06 +08:00
Changhua
05922c59ad Rename uint64 to QWORD 2024-06-10 16:23:33 +08:00
Changhua
e84473ec1b Impl send image 2024-06-10 16:05:43 +08:00
Changhua
68822467ff Update send image offset 2024-06-10 16:04:36 +08:00